BAKERSFIELD, Calif. - A steady stream of residents walked through the doors of the Chase Bank branch in downtown Bakersfield on Friday afternoon, not to deposit checks or open accounts, but to take part in a free financial education workshop. The event, organized by the nonprofit group FLTA, was designed to break down the barriers that often keep people from taking control of their money.
The workshop covered practical topics like creating a realistic monthly budget, setting up automatic savings, and understanding credit scores. Volunteers from the nonprofit sat down with attendees one-on-one, answering questions and helping them map out small, achievable steps. For many in the room, the most powerful message was simple: it is never too late to start.
Organizers stressed that financial struggles are common and nothing to be ashamed of. They wanted to create a welcoming space where people could learn without judgment. One attendee, a single mother of two, said she came in feeling overwhelmed by debt but left with a clear plan to tackle it a little at a time.
The event was free and open to everyone, regardless of income or banking history. FLTA leaders say they plan to hold similar sessions in other neighborhoods in the coming months, hoping to reach more people who want to build stability but do not know where to begin. The atmosphere was upbeat, with several participants staying long after the formal presentations ended to ask follow-up questions and share their own experiences.
